First, the myth: OTF daily workouts demand hours of high-intensity grind.

Many online guides sell the idea as a 45-minute daily sprint. In practice, effective OTF training requires intentionality, not duration. Research from the Journal of Strength and Conditioning Research shows that optimal hypertrophy and neuromuscular adaptation occur with 3–4 sessions weekly, each lasting 30–40 minutes—focused, deliberate, and varied. The body adapts quickly, but only when challenged systematically, not just repeated endlessly.

Third, recovery is non-negotiable—and often overlooked.

OTF athletes succeed not because they train harder, but because they train smarter. Deload weeks, strategic nutrition, and sleep optimization are not optional. A 2023 meta-analysis in Sports Health revealed that overtraining reduces performance by up to 20% and increases injury risk—especially in high-velocity, compound movements.

The OTF philosophy embraces this: progress isn’t linear. Rest days aren’t setbacks; they’re essential for neural recovery and tissue repair. Fourth, individual variability is the silent variable.

One person’s “daily workout” can feel like a full-day sprint to another. Age, injury history, biomechanics, and recovery capacity reshape how OTF principles apply.
